The Western Force have come from behind to snatch a 16-15 win over the Melbourne Rebels in the Super Rugby Australia last night.

The Force hit the front for the first time in the 77th minute, with Domingo Miotti converting a Tim Anstee try to break the hearts of the Rebels fans.

The Rebels had 65% of possession but could not manage a try, with the Force mauling the ball across after a five-metre lineout for their sole five-pointer.

But the Force's defence deserved credit in a game filled with errors from both teams.

Meanwhile, the Reds will face the Brumbies at 9.45 tonight.
